Product Overview
The Precise Binocular Dripper introduces the revolutionary concept of wet blending to manual coffee brewing. Featuring a distinctive binocular-style dual-chamber design, this manual pour-over dripper allows you to brew two different coffees simultaneously with completely independent parameters (grind size, dose, and pour control) and merge them perfectly into a single cup during extraction.
Whether you are a professional barista in a specialty café or a home brewing enthusiast looking to experiment, this dripper offers unmatched control, thermal stability, and a clean visual presentation.
Key Features
- Dual-Cone Wet Blending: Brew two distinct coffees side-by-side and let them blend seamlessly during extraction.
- Total Independent Control: Adjust the grind size, coffee dose, and water pour timing separately for each cone to highlight unique flavor profiles.
- Premium Thermal Stability: Made of high-quality, low-mass plastic that maintains a stable temperature throughout the brew.
- Enhanced Extraction (30° Walls): Engineered with 30° wall angles for deeper coffee beds, reducing water bypass and maximizing extraction efficiency—perfect for small-dose brews.
- 100% Manual, No Electronics: Purely mechanical design built for ultimate reliability, repeatability, and creative experimentation.

How to Use
- Place a folded V60 filter paper into each of the two independent cones.
- Add your choice of coffee to each side. You can use different beans, doses, or grind sizes for each chamber.
- Pour water over both sides simultaneously or stagger your pours to control how the flavors interact.
- Watch the coffees merge directly into the single included server during extraction for a perfectly blended final cup.
